### Seat-map renderer: getting set up

Quick context for the sync: Stagewright draws the Orpheline Theatre's seat maps from a vector manifest, so local dev needs the manifest service running. Clone the repo, run `make bootstrap`, and copy `.env.sample` to `.env`. Most defaults are fine for hall layouts. The renderer also needs to authenticate against the manifest API — put that credential on the line right after this setup.

sealed setting: RELAY_SECRET5=82864

- [ ] **Step 7: Breaker override escrow.** After sealing the signing keys for the Tallgrove upstream API circuit breaker, confirm the support team can force the breaker open during a full outage. The override bundle lives in the sealed escrow drawer and is useless without its unlock phrase. Two ceremony witnesses must initial this step before proceeding. The escrow bundle is decrypted with the recovery passphrase that follows.

vault phrase of kahip-kahop = holath-quenmir

## Turnstile Upgrade — What the Desk Needs to Know

Heads up: the old swing turnstiles in the Varley Court lobby are being swapped for the new Gatewright units over the next fortnight. Expect grumbling — the readers sit lower and people will tap too high for a while. During the changeover, lane 3 stays open as a manual gate, and the desk should wave through anyone whose badge fails rather than re-enrolling them on the spot. The temporary override keypad on lane 3 takes the code below.

turnstile pass: bdg-FVNQRS-72965873

Quick vendor note for newcomers: we license the Fernquill template engine from Opalbridge Labs. It's fast enough, but their default config re-parses templates on every render — always enable the compiled cache flag or page loads crawl. Opalbridge ships patches quarterly, and we test before adopting. Questions about the contract or benchmarks go to their account rep.

escalation mailbox, yajeg-bageg: quenax.olidor@lumiccorp.internal